Transaction ef2c30ea3117602bf164777440f2aaf586600234ca19007a44d29ac586f9b2c1
1 Input
1 Output
-
ef2c30ea3117602bf164777440f2aaf586600234ca19007a44d29ac586f9b2c1:0
- value
- 28014021
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d72f2cbf5d316e4a30fc1a7b7924f31c1af4170 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CSKAjemuni7Lyr2mUYry8BrsFWBG37dab